- (a) Establishing customer participation in service costs encourages customer commitment to an employment outcome, creates a cooperative relationship between the customer and the Vocational Rehabilitation Division (VRD), and maximizes VRD's limited funds.
- (b) VRD may require customers to participate in the cost of services based on financial need, unless the customer is a recipient of Social Security benefits, either Supplemental Security Income or Social Security Disability Insurance.
